Rancho Feeding Corp. co-owner sentenced to one year in prison
Robert Digitale, Press Democrat, February 10, 2016
Jesse “Babe” Amaral Jr., the Rancho Feeding slaughterhouse owner whose sale of meat from condemned and uninspected cattle lead to a nationwide food recall two years ago, on Wednesday was sentenced to one year in federal prison and a year of supervised release.
Amaral, 78, was the last of four defendants to plead guilty to what prosecutors called “an outrageous scheme to distribute adulterated meat” for human consumption from the Petaluma slaughterhouse.
The scheme included fooling federal meat inspectors at the plant by secretly switching the heads of questionable cattle with those from apparently healthy animals.
Federal investigators first raided the Rancho facility in early 2014. By February, Amaral had closed the plant on Petaluma Boulevard North as part of the federal recall of 8.7 million pounds of meat, essentially a year’s worth of supply.
